AI Image Generator

Generate images using AI APIs (Google Gemini and OpenAI GPT). This skill teaches the prompting patterns and API mechanics for producing professional images directly from Claude Code.

Model Selection

Choose the right model for the job:

Need Model Why

Photorealistic scenes / stock photos Gemini 3.1 Flash Image Best depth, complexity, environmental context

Final client scenes (higher detail) Gemini 3 Pro Image Higher detail, better style consistency

Text on images (posters, OG with copy, infographics) GPT Image 2 Text rendering actually works — including multi-script

10-variation style exploration GPT Image 2 Native batch — one prompt, 10 variants sharing composition + palette

Multi-reference compositing (product + lifestyle) GPT Image 2 Handles lighting, scale, perspective across references

Transparent icons / logos GPT Image 1.5 Native RGBA alpha — GPT Image 2 cannot do transparency

Quick drafts / iteration Gemini 2.5 Flash Image Free tier (~500/day)

Rule of thumb: any image with readable text → GPT Image 2 (unless you need transparency, then GPT 1.5). Otherwise → Gemini.

GPT Image 2 Specifics

Released 2026-04-22. Three capabilities that change when you'd reach for it.

  1. Text rendering actually works

Posters, OG images with headlines, infographics with labels, UI mockups, pricing cards. Text is rendered reliably, including non-Latin scripts (Japanese, Korean, Hindi, Bengali). Primary reason to switch from Gemini — Gemini doesn't render readable text at all.

  1. Multi-variation batching

One prompt, up to 10 images in a single call. Variants share composition and palette but differ in detail. Good for style exploration before committing, A/B options for a client, rapid ideation.

  1. Multi-reference compositing

Feed reference images alongside your prompt — product shots, lifestyle scenes, logos. The model places the product into the scene with correct lighting, scale, perspective. Enables "product in context" workflows without multi-turn editing.

Modes

  • Instant (default, all plans) — generates without a planning pass. Fast, good enough for most cases.

  • Thinking (Plus/Pro/Business plans) — plans layout before drawing. Use when element counts matter ("3 icons in a row", "5 feature bullets") or text must land in specific regions. Fewer re-rolls on complex compositions.

Aspect ratios

3:1 ultra-wide through 1:3 ultra-tall, plus 1:1, 3:2, 2:3, 16:9, 9:16. Wider range than other models — useful for website banners (ultra-wide hero) or mobile story formats (ultra-tall).

Resolution

Up to 2K on the long edge standard. 4K in beta.

Generation time

Up to 2 minutes on complex prompts. Build async UX — don't block on the response. Show progress or spin off and poll.

Constraints

  • No transparent backgrounds. Fall back to gpt-image-1.5 when you need PNG transparency.

  • API Org Verification may be required before the endpoint fires — enable in your OpenAI account settings if you hit auth errors on first call.

The 5-Part Prompting Framework

Build prompts in this order for consistent results:

  1. Image Type

Set the genre: "A photorealistic photograph", "An isometric illustration", "A flat vector icon"

  1. Subject

Who or what, with specific details: "of a warm, approachable Australian woman in her early 30s, smiling naturally"

  1. Environment

Setting and spatial relationships: "in a bright modern home with terracotta decor on wooden shelves behind her"

  1. Technical Specs

Camera and lighting: "Shot at 85mm f/2.0, natural window light, head and shoulders framing"

  1. Constraints

What to exclude: "Photorealistic, no text, no watermarks, no logos"

Example (Good vs Bad)

BAD — keyword soup: "professional woman, spa, warm lighting, high quality, 4K"

GOOD — narrative direction: "A professional skin treatment scene in a warm clinical setting. A practitioner wearing blue medical gloves uses a microneedling pen on the client's forehead. The client lies on a white treatment bed, eyes closed, relaxed. Warm golden-hour light from a window to the left. Terracotta-toned wall visible in the background. Shot at 85mm f/2.0, shallow depth of field. No text, no watermarks."

Multi-Turn Editing

Gemini supports editing a generated image across conversation turns. The key requirement: preserve thought signatures from model responses.

Turn 1: Generate base image

contents = [{"role": "user", "parts": [{"text": "Scene prompt..."}]}]

The response includes thoughtSignature on parts — preserve them ALL

Turn 2: Edit the image

contents = [ {"role": "user", "parts": [{"text": "Original prompt"}]}, {"role": "model", "parts": response_parts_with_signatures}, # Keep intact {"role": "user", "parts": [{"text": "Edit: change the wall colour to blue. Keep everything else exactly the same."}]} ]

Edit prompt pattern: Always specify what to KEEP unchanged, not just what to change. The model treats unlisted elements as free to modify.

GOOD: "Edit this image: keep the people, desk, and window unchanged. Only change: wall colour from terracotta to ocean blue."

BAD: "Now make the wall blue." (Model may change everything else too)

Common Mistakes

Mistake Fix

Using curl for Gemini prompts Use Python — shell escaping breaks on apostrophes

"Beautiful, professional, high quality" Use concrete specs: "85mm f/1.8, golden hour light"

Not specifying what to exclude Always end with "No text, no watermarks, no logos"

Requesting transparent PNG from Gemini Gemini cannot do transparency — use GPT Image 1.5 with background: "transparent"

Requesting transparent PNG from GPT Image 2 GPT Image 2 cannot do transparency — fall back to gpt-image-1.5 for this case only

Using GPT Image 1.5 for text on images GPT Image 1.5 text rendering is unreliable — use gpt-image-2 for any readable text

Blocking a request to GPT Image 2 Generation can take up to 2 min on complex prompts — use 180s timeout, build async UX

American defaults for AU businesses Explicitly specify "Australian" + local architecture, vegetation

Generic data for model ID Verify current model IDs — they change frequently
